Detailed Guide

Cut an 8 inch wide by 44 inch long (20.32 cm by
111.76 cm) strip.

Put the right sides together so the strip measures 8 inches by 22 inches (20.32 cm by
55.88 cm). , Use a 1/4-inch (.635 cm) seam. , The right side of the fabric should be facing the outside.

Fold the open edge under 1/2 inch (1.27 cm).

Press together. , Begin and end 2 inches (5.08 cm) from the top and bottom of the bag. , Fill no more than 2/3 full. , Place the pins sideways.

Drape the bag around your neck, elbow, knee, or anywhere else you might use it to make sure it lays properly.

If not, it may be too full.

Adjust the amount of dried corn as needed. ,, Make sure the corn is completely dry by placing the bag on a paper towel in the microwave.

Heat the corn bag for 2 to 3 minutes, then let it cool for at least 2 hours.

Shake the bag well and then repeat the process using a dry paper towel.

If the second paper towel is damp after microwaving, cool the bag for at least 2 hours and repeat the process a third time.
